@ -1,4 +1,15 @@
===============================================================================
20.44.1
Updates:
Added perfect forwarding for alternative callback for etl::delegate::call_or()
Pull Requests:
#1208 array noexcept expr
Fixed ETL_NOEXCEPT_EXPR for etl::array
Added ETL_NOEXCEPT for zero sized etl::array specialisation.
===============================================================================
